I’ve always wondered what you looked like as you left before I was born.

Perhaps at that time, I was too young to remember what you looked like or have I really not seen you before?
However, I have seen you in the photographs. In the photographs, you wore a headband and round glasses and had a broad smile on your face.

My siblings also said you were very nice and dote on them, but I never had the chance.

They also said that you are a bright-lit candle. When they were upset or having problems, you were always by their side, giving them solutions and consoling them, but I could never experience that.

I think that I am the only one in the family who has not even seen you. I really hope I can spend just one day with you.

Just one day!

I still have the thing that you made. It is the quilt you had sewn.

Sometimes, when I see the quilt, I will imagine you smiling at me.
